15. El Desierto - Lhasa de Sela (La Llorona, 1998)

Ms. de Sela passed away last year at the age of 37 from breast cancer. I didn’t find out about it until recently, because I haven’t heard anything from her in long while and didn’t think to check if she was kicking around still. Artists would release albums and go on hiatus all the time, and the sheer volume of music I’ve heard over the years means that I don’t assume death whenever I don’t hear from somebody for some time. It’s sad that I didn’t hear about it in the news at the time though, because she was one true international artist of note that should be present on every music lover’s playlist. She could sing in English, French, and Spanish, with a soulful voice that packed power, nuances, and a deep well of emotions. This was such a great loss - everyone dies, but it was just a tad too soon in her case. She had a lot more music in her, but we’ll never know now.
